Morocco is currently observing a domestic general government health expenditure as a % of general government expenditure of 6.8%, marking a decrease of 0.4% (-5.6%) compared to 2021.

Morocco Government health expenditure (% of government) between 2000 and 2022
| Period |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2022 | 6.8% | -0.4% |
| 2021 | 7.2% | +0% |
| 2020 | 7.2% | -0.2% |
| 2019 | 7.4% | +0.2% |
| 2018 | 7.2% | +0.1% |
| 2017 | 7.1% | +0.1% |
| 2016 | 7% | +0% |
| 2015 | 7% | +0.1% |
| 2014 | 6.8% | +0.8% |
| 2013 | 6% | +0.3% |
| 2012 | 5.7% | -0.1% |
| 2011 | 5.8% | -0.3% |
| 2010 | 6.1% | -0.1% |
| 2009 | 6.1% | +0.8% |
| 2008 | 5.3% | -0% |
| 2007 | 5.4% | +0.3% |
| 2006 | 5% | +1.2% |
| 2005 | 3.9% | -0.3% |
| 2004 | 4.1% | -0% |
| 2003 | 4.1% | -0% |
| 2002 | 4.2% | -0% |
| 2001 | 4.2% | +0.1% |
| 2000 | 4.1% |
